The quarantine terminal is well worth an appearance, with over forty structures stretched out over a large grassy location that were built from the 1850s forward to manage new kid on the blocks with flu, leprosy, and other contagious illness. At the other end of the park, at the extremely suggestion of the Mornington Peninsula, exists Ft Nepean.

Better out on the Peninsula, in the direction of its suggestion at Point Nepean, Victoria's Quarantine Terminal operated for over 100 years (and is currently open to the general public). Point Nepean likewise houses Fort Nepean, a network of strongholds, weapon locations and barracks constructed to protect the entrance to Port Phillip. look at this now Much of the Mornington Peninsula has actually been removed, yet there is still enough all-natural greenery for some high quality bushwalking.
